  • If you breed, say a male pinstripe and spider to a female pastel, can you get eggs from each of the dads?

  • @TPReptiles You certainly can! The thing people don't always grasp is that the males genes can't cross. So you could get lemonblasts and bumblebees, but no spinners or spinnerblasts. I'm hoping for a multiple paternity clutch or two this year. I'll keep ya posted!
